logo

Output 40f8d249c18aa91bce4441ac3882c43a86275922917a1227f19f038d8998814b:1

value
21932719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3c17373b940238b05d0904f98e8ca58f4c4a9e OP_EQUAL
address
3HaHV6YMKrxPUCFFNSqFkhmSfbJX7VHfQn
transaction
40f8d249c18aa91bce4441ac3882c43a86275922917a1227f19f038d8998814b